Transaction 77bce422382eda73d48a132fcaf54eabbda5a052a01eea8a34a7f62dd2ee72da

1 Input
2 Outputs
  • 77bce422382eda73d48a132fcaf54eabbda5a052a01eea8a34a7f62dd2ee72da:0
  • value  125674259
    address  3LRhstXBDNEmGvcgiWR3p7JFXSFa392CZo
  • 77bce422382eda73d48a132fcaf54eabbda5a052a01eea8a34a7f62dd2ee72da:1
  • value  605803
    address  3M7r6YNDXP3KGzZA192yHevnvg5gCj223S